Nigeria news : Benue University VC, Prof Hembe tests positive for COVID-19, warns staff, The Vice-Chancellor Of Benue State University, Professor Msugh Hembe, has tested positive for COVID-19.

Professor Hembe confirmed his status on his Facebook page, adding that the results of his coronavirus test returned on Monday and it was confirmed positive.

The VC further instructed all staff of the university and close associates to undergo test and isolate themselves.

According to him, he went for a test after he was down with fever and fatigue the previous week.

His post read “On Monday, 29th June, 2020, my test result for COVID-19 returned positive.

“I have been in isolation since I found out on Monday about my positive exposure to the virus.

“Staff of Benue State University and close associates are advised to check themselves, isolate and be pragmatic.

He warned everyone to take responsibility, adding that “the virus doesn’t move; we move it. Take responsibility.”
